XNA プロジェクトの Live/GamerServices の代替手段はありますか?

StackOverflow https://stackoverflow.com/questions/100459

  •  01-07-2019
  •  | 
  •  

質問

XNA の GamerServices コンポーネントを使用してネットワーク目的で Xbox/GfW Live にアクセスするには、開発者とプレーヤーがそれぞれ、Microsoft の Creators Club に年間 100 米ドルのサブスクリプションを持っている必要があります。Xbox360 XNA プロジェクトでは、ゲームを 360 に配置するにはサブスクリプションが必要なので、これは大きな問題ではありません。

しかし、XNA を使用する PC ゲームの場合、プレイヤーのゲーマー カードにアクセスするためだけに開発者とプレイヤーに毎年これほどの金額を支払う必要があるのは、かなりクレイジーです。GamerServices と同様の利点を提供する XNA ゲーム用のソリューションはありますか?それとも、プレイヤー (そして自分自身) を 1 人あたり 100 ドルの打撃にさらしたくない場合、開発者は独自のネットワーク機能を構築することにほぼ制限されているのでしょうか?

役に立ちましたか?

解決

試してみてもいいかもしれません リドグレン

他のヒント

Windows Live 用のゲームは現在無料です。http://www.engadget.com/2008/07/22/games-for-windows-live-now-free/

Xbox と zune では Live API を使用することが唯一の選択肢であるため、Windows ではコストが唯一の問題だったため、非常に魅力的なオプションになります :-) 特に、一度ゲーム スタジオ 3.0 が起動すると、次のことが可能になるという事実を考慮すると、 Xbox Live の新しいコミュニティ ゲーム セクションでゲームを販売する

編集、さらに調査したところ、Windows Live 用のゲームはある意味中途半端であることがわかりました。gamerservices ライブラリは再頒布可能ビットには含まれていないようです。したがって、EULA に違反したくない場合を除き、プレーヤーは gamestudio をインストールする必要があります。そうは言っても、不便ではないにしても、それでも無料であると私は信じています。

もちろん、ソケットを使用できます。ソケットを使用すると、別個の専用サーバー アプリを作成できますが、Live では (私の知る限りでは) これはできません。SteamWorks を試すこともできます。しかし、それを試した人は聞いたことがありません。

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top